International Dyslexia Association (IDA)
The International Dyslexia Association (IDA) is an international organization that concerns itself with the complex issues of dyslexia. The IDA membership consists of a variety of professionals in partnership with dyslexics and their families and all others interested in The Association’s mission. The IDA actively promotes effective teaching approaches and related clinical educational intervention strategies for dyslexics.

Learning Disabilities Association of America (LDA)
A parent-professional organization to provide information about learning disabilities and advocate for children and adults with learning disabilities. LDA has state and local affiliates in most states. National Office, 4156 Library Road, Pittsburgh, PA 15234.

LD Online
A web site developed by the Coordinated Campaign for Learning Disabilities to provide information about learning disabilities and resources. A site for parents, teachers, children, and adults with learning disabilities, and anyone interested in learning disabilities.

National Center for Learning Disabilities (NCLD)
Provides information about learning disabilities.

National Information Center for Children and Youth with Disabilities (NICHY)
An information clearing house that provides free information on disabilities and disabilities-related issues.

National Institute of Child Health and Human Development (NICHD)
NICHD has been funding and conducting research on learning disabilities for many years. Recently their research on learning disabilities in reading decoding (dyslexia) has identified some major cognitive processes underlying reading disabilities. They have explored approaches for teaching children with these specific problems.
